Output 32e7cd36f13a078cb9c48193943107315d4c3a74482a93f2b41ae1f736d861a6:1

value
2997965
script pubkey
OP_0 OP_PUSHBYTES_20 bab22937666bec398352fa918f49446772963aaf
address
bc1qh2ezjdmxd0krnq6jl2gc7j2yvaefvw40ugrrcf
transaction
32e7cd36f13a078cb9c48193943107315d4c3a74482a93f2b41ae1f736d861a6
spent
true